It's a big deal because you can link FGO to something outside of the game itself instead of using one-time only transfer codes. So, for example, if you lose or break your phone but forgot to create a new transfer code, you can still get your account without having to go through the recovery process.
But yes, you were mistaken about playing on multiple devices. This is strictly for transfers from one device to another, not for logging into the game itself. At its core, FGO is still a Japanese mobile-only game from 2014/15, where the gaming market consists of phones and consoles and the presumption is that mobile games are being played on the train or during lunch breaks and the idea of playing on PC is figuratively, and perhaps literally, foreign. I'm pretty sure that under the hood, it actually still uses transfer codes to do the transfer. If you want to switch between devices, you still have to transfer every time. You just don't have to create a new transfer code every time.
